Q. What forms of drone programs do you supply?
A. Considered one of our programs is the distant pilot certificates (RPC). On this five-day programme, college students bear coaching and obtain a license legitimate for ten years, permitting them to fly drones wherever in India (Inexperienced Zone). Moreover, we’ve developed a seven-day agriculture spray course. These agricultural drones used for spraying are considerably heavier, round 20 to 25kg, in comparison with the two to 3kg coaching drones. To deal with this, we’ve designed a complete course the place; after finishing the RPC, college students discover ways to function agricultural drones for spraying. These are the 2 key programs associated to pilot coaching that we provide. Q. What are the necessities and construction of your five-day course?
A. We’ve 4 DGCA-approved bases, that are open for public viewing. The method is easy: it’s a five-day course with two days devoted to principle courses, at some point for simulator coaching and two days to sensible flying. Our toll-free quantity connects on to our supportive crew. For eligibility, candidates who’ve accomplished at the least the Tenth and Twelfth-grade schooling requirements are certified to enrol in our program.
Q. Are your programs carried out on-line or offline?
A. All these programs are carried out offline. Based on the NSQF mandate, we can’t present on-line coaching within the Kisan Drone Operator programme. Nevertheless, for the RPC certificates, the idea class is carried out on-line over two days, whereas the remaining three days are offline and devoted to sensible flying courses.

Q. What are the prices and situations in your drone coaching programs?
A. Based on market requirements, our drone pilot coaching course prices 35,000 INR plus GST for a five-day programme. The price of different courses varies primarily based on their length. Our drone meeting and repair technician programs are sometimes run underneath government-subsidised programmes, so candidates should not charged for these. In case of paid programs, the beginning payment is 35,000 INR plus GST. If a trainee purchases a drone from us, this payment is adjusted, and we offer the coaching at no further cost. Subsequently, when somebody buys a drone, we guarantee they’re educated to function it with out additional price. Q. What are the {qualifications} and evaluation processes required by the DGCA to develop into a licensed drone teacher?
A. Based on DGCA laws, candidates should be graduates, maintain an RPC, and be RPI-certified. The DGCA, because the regulatory physique, conducts rigorous viva and assessments for candidates aspiring to develop into instructors. This can be a difficult examination course of. Solely these certified by the DGCA can develop into instructors and will need to have a specific amount of flying expertise. Q. What’s the course of for acquiring a pilot certificates by means of your coaching program?
A. College students should full a set variety of flying hours within the curriculum. As soon as these hours are accomplished, the small print are submitted to Bharat Kosh, a portal the place we generate a challan to subject a pilot certificates to the coed. Moreover, we submit these particulars to the DGCA web site. On the DGCA platform, you possibly can see quite a few distant pilot certificates generated on-line and offline.

Q. How do you manufacture drones and supply parts?
A. Our meeting line is situated in Gurgaon Sector 10, the place we manufacture and assemble drones. Some parts are produced in-house, whereas others are sourced from suppliers. Regardless of dealing with a lot of the drone manufacturing in-house, we can’t produce some components like firmware, touchdown gears, motors, ourselves, so we depend on a pool of provider for these. It’s also not possible to supply every part internally. That is how our drone meeting line operates. We additionally use 3D printing to create components in-house and supply parts like propellers from Indian suppliers and never different nations. We adhere to the ‘Make in India’ initiative, as 80% of our components are domestically sourced.
Q. What makes your drone distinctive and extremely environment friendly?
A. We’ve developed a singular drone referred to as Viraj with two distinct payloads; a twig system and a seed spreader. This permits customers to not solely spray fields but in addition to unfold seeds effectively. Moreover, we provide a drone with night time imaginative and prescient capabilities, enabling spraying operations to be carried out even at nighttime. These stand out as a consequence of their distinctive stability and spectacular flight length. Every drone can function for no less than 16 to 17 minutes on a single battery cost, protecting an space of roughly two to 2 and a half acres inside that time-frame. Additionally, Viraj is able to flying 500 hours with none main upkeep, and this characteristic makes it the bottom upkeep and cost-effective for the tip customers.
